Transaction 122f6e57ca9115285bb97be51f2ebedc3904d4a4e679f1622bd022a1270e8539

1 Input
2 Outputs
  • 122f6e57ca9115285bb97be51f2ebedc3904d4a4e679f1622bd022a1270e8539:0
  • value  25377338
    address  31hLBe1szdqUhyWg2p2qvABy6DyQg2kSvU
  • 122f6e57ca9115285bb97be51f2ebedc3904d4a4e679f1622bd022a1270e8539:1
  • value  4680849
    address  1LEqvRQ4oL2qiU9ihcL2LJghGSXd2GxW5F